WhatsApp Scams. Yes, it is happening.

Just when we managed to have our scam detectors calibrated for email, “they” are now getting us on WhatsApp.

Simple formula, get your number.

Unsolicited contact.

Promossing you a freelance opportunity.

Just had the conversation. Phone number is from India (note: nothing against the country I love Virat and Sachin was one of my all-time heroes), with a male profile pick. Introduce “himself” or “herself” as Anne Wilson from Travel Media Group, promising me R1000 per day doing digital marketing jobs and all I need to do is join their private WhatsApp group.

Problem is…

They contacted me a few months ago as well.

Asked me for a lot of personal information.

Had a short chat with Anne who looks like a dude, but hey it is a new world after all.

Asked where they got my number, here is his answer:

By using cookies and geofencing, we gathered online connections at random from social media sites depending on the locations and interests.We are not personally acquainted with you, instead, we used an online random selection tool to gather data for this job..
